What Are the Different Types of IDBI Bank Forms and How to Fill Them?

Types of IDBI Bank Forms

IDBI Bank offers a variety of forms tailored to meet the needs of its customers across different banking services. Understanding these forms is essential for efficient banking. Here are the primary categories:

  • Account & Banking Forms: These include forms for account opening for individuals, sole proprietorships, and non-individual entities. Also included are channel registration forms for services like debit cards and internet banking.
  • Loan Application Forms: IDBI Bank provides specific forms for various loan types such as Auto Loans, Education Loans, Home Loans, and Personal Loans.
  • Investment & Savings Forms: This category includes forms for fixed deposits and small savings schemes, such as the Senior Citizens Savings Scheme (SCSS), along with forms for account closure and premature withdrawal.
  • Miscellaneous Forms: These forms cover various services, including Doorstep Banking for senior citizens, Foreign Inward Remittances, and FATCA/CRS Declaration Forms.

How to Fill Out IDBI Bank Forms

Filling out IDBI Bank forms accurately is crucial for processing applications without delays. Here are detailed steps to ensure correctness:

  • Download the Form: Access the IDBI Bank website and locate the "Apply Now" or "Download Forms" section to find the specific form you need.
  • Use Capital Letters and Black Ink: Fill in all required fields using CAPITAL LETTERS and BLACK INK. This is a standard requirement for clarity.
  • Follow Section-Wise Instructions: Each form typically includes detailed instructions at the end. Reviewing these can help you understand how to complete each section accurately.
  • Verify Personal Details: Ensure that your name and other personal information match your proof of identity. This is vital for Know Your Customer (KYC) compliance.
  • Provide Supporting Documents: Attach necessary documents as specified in the form, such as proof of identity, address verification, or income statements.
  • Sign Appropriately: Your signature must correspond to the mode of holding specified in the application, whether as a sole applicant or as part of a joint account.

Common Mistakes to Avoid

Filling out IDBI Bank forms can be straightforward, but common mistakes can lead to application delays. Here are some pitfalls to avoid:

  • Incomplete Information: Ensure all required fields are filled out. Leaving sections blank can result in rejection.
  • Incorrect Document Submission: Double-check that you are submitting the correct documents as specified in the form instructions.
  • Signature Issues: Make sure your signature matches the one on your identification documents to avoid discrepancies.
  • Ignoring Guidelines: Each form has specific guidelines. Ignoring these can lead to processing delays or rejections.

Required Documents for IDBI Bank Forms

When filling out IDBI Bank forms, specific documents are often required to support your application. Here’s a list of commonly needed documents:

  • Proof of Identity: This may include a government-issued ID, such as a driver's license or passport.
  • Proof of Address: Utility bills, lease agreements, or bank statements can serve as valid proof of your current address.
  • Income Proof: For loan applications, documents like pay stubs, tax returns, or bank statements may be required.
  • Photographs: Recent passport-sized photographs are typically needed for account opening forms.
